Overview
As a Business Development Representative, your primary responsibility will be to identify, target, and engage with Director, VP, and C-suite executives at potential client companies. You will use your communication and relationship-building skills to set meetings for our sales team and contribute directly to revenue growth.
Responsibilities
- Prospecting and Research: Identify and research logistics companies that are a strong fit for Rapido, including brokerages, carriers, and logistics technology providers. Build an understanding of each company’s operating model, growth stage, and potential support gaps.
- Consistently generate new conversations through thoughtful outbound activity across email, LinkedIn, and phone. Build a healthy pipeline of qualified meetings by focusing on relevance and timing rather than volume alone.
- Targeted Outreach and Engagement: Initiate contact with Directors, VPs, and C-level leaders through personalized messaging that speaks directly to operational pain points such as coverage gaps, cost pressure, scalability, and team burnout.
- Discovery and Qualification: Hold initial conversations to understand a prospect’s current workflows, team structure, challenges, and decision making process. Qualify opportunities based on need, urgency, and overall fit for Rapido’s nearshore model.
- Meeting Setting and Handoff: Set high quality meetings for the sales team with clear context, notes, and expectations. Ensure each meeting is well positioned and aligned with sales objectives and the prospect’s priorities.
- Relationship Building: Develop trust with prospects through consistent follow up, transparency, and a consultative approach. Stay engaged even when timing is not immediate to build long term pipeline value.
- CRM and Reporting: Maintain accurate and timely records of outreach, conversations, and next steps within the CRM. Use data to track progress, improve messaging, and stay aligned with team goals.
- Performance and Incentives: Earn performance based bonuses tied to meetings set and deals closed, reinforcing accountability, consistency, and impact on company growth.
